Tinubu Action Man, Working To Make Nigeria Better – Buba Galadima

Galadima said the decisions Tinubu had taken as President had indicated that he’s determined to make Nigeria a better place.

Buba Galadima has said that Tinubu is an action man and working to make Nigeria better,

 

NewsOnline reports that Buba Galadima, a chieftain of the New Nigeria Peoples Party, NNPP, has described President Bola Tinubu as an action man working to make Nigeria a better place.

 

Galadima said the decisions Tinubu had taken as President had indicated that he’s determined to make Nigeria a better place.

Speaking in Abuja, the NNPP chieftain urged the President to maintain the tempo.

 

According to Galadima: “For those of us who have been in trenches in politics for the last 45 years, you will know that this time around the difference is clear.

 

“We do appreciate Mr President and so far he hasn’t disappointed us for having been on the right track so far.

“We do pray and hope that the action man will continue the work he is doing to make Nigeria a better place for us.”
